I was just wondering how caster maces compared to melee maces, as far as prot is concerned (both tanking and solo grinding).

For example, just looking at a couple level 70 rare maces, it appears there is a 30 DPS drop from the melee to the caster mace. However, there's an 11 DPS upgrade to SoR from the caster mace (121*0.092 = 11.1), so if you use SoR it would only be a 20 DPS decrease...but if you factor in all the other things it would benefit (consecrate, SoV, JoR/V) would it be worth it to go for a caster weapon?

When you get to 70, it's generally accepted that you need around 200 spell damage to be able to hold threat well enough. This increases as you get to higher raids, but for regular 5-mans, Heroics, and Kara, ~200 spell damage is what you should aim for. (I'm at 181 myself, and I generate threat well enough.)

It doesn't really matter how you get there, however the easiest way to do that is through your weapon. They tend to have the highest amount of spell damage while not gimping your tanking stats. If you use your armor you don't have to get a spell damage weapon, however you tend to gimp your tanking stats more.

The agreed upon most desirable weapon for a long time is the [wowitem=32660]Crystalforged Sword[/wowitem].

An alternate you can get from revered with KoT is the [wowitem=29185]Continuum Blade[/wowitem]

however the best tanking weapon I have seen is an arena reward the [wowitem=32963]Merciless Gladiator's Gavel[/wowitem], however there will probably be a better one in s3 so we'll see.
